CMYK Swatch Book ($25.00)

C…M…Y… What? CMYK refers to the 4 colors printers (cyan, magenta, yellow and black… which is referred to as “k”) use to create all printable colors. Now you might be wondering why a designer might need this gem if they can select from millions of more colors on their design program. The answer is that there are 3 different color processes a design program can handle. RGB (red, green and blue) is used for all digital designs, CMYK is used for print designs and Pantone (the universal print color that will print exactly how it looks) can also be used for print.
